Output fbaa633757f2f8e655578cc8febc17d28e4893884d3b81eaf96b6fd933559961:2

value
5000000
script pubkey
OP_0 OP_PUSHBYTES_20 ce28a228bcfb7734d17c05f964594d18e9103261
address
bc1qec52y29uldmnf5tuqhukgk2drr53qvnp9x2gek
transaction
fbaa633757f2f8e655578cc8febc17d28e4893884d3b81eaf96b6fd933559961